背景技术Background Art

在混凝土的生产过程中,有时会添加混凝土旧料或者建筑废料,以合理利用废旧资源,而利用混凝土旧料或者建筑废料在生产混凝土时,往往需要通过破碎辊等破碎装置来破碎混凝土旧料或者建筑废料,以便于各原料的混合,授权公告号为CN215963708U公开了一种混凝土生产用破碎装置,所述粉碎箱的内部连接有两个粉碎辊,所述粉碎箱的两侧均安装有固定板,两个所述固定板的下表面均安装有第二支撑杆,所述除尘机构包括两个风扇槽,但是此破碎装置容易堵塞过滤板,影响二次破碎的效率,为此我们提出了一种混凝土生产用破碎装置。In the production process of concrete, old concrete materials or construction waste are sometimes added to reasonably utilize waste resources. When using old concrete materials or construction waste to produce concrete, it is often necessary to use crushing devices such as crushing rollers to crush the old concrete materials or construction waste to facilitate the mixing of various raw materials. Authorization announcement number CN215963708U discloses a crushing device for concrete production, wherein two crushing rollers are connected to the inside of the crushing box, fixed plates are installed on both sides of the crushing box, and second support rods are installed on the lower surfaces of the two fixed plates. The dust removal mechanism includes two fan slots, but this crushing device is easy to clog the filter plate, affecting the efficiency of secondary crushing. For this reason, we propose a crushing device for concrete production.

具体实施方式DETAILED DESCRIPTION

下面将结合本实用新型实施例中的附图,对本实用新型实施例中的技术方案进行清楚、完整地描述,显然,所描述的实施例仅仅是本实用新型一部分实施例,而不是全部的实施例。The technical solutions in the embodiments of the present invention will be described clearly and completely below in conjunction with the drawings in the embodiments of the present invention. Obviously, the described embodiments are only part of the embodiments of the present invention, rather than all of the embodiments.

实施例一Embodiment 1

参照图1-图3,一种混凝土生产用破碎装置,包括粉碎箱1,粉碎箱1的两侧设置有两个气缸2,两个气缸2的伸缩杆上均固定安装有挤压针板3,两个挤压针板3相互配合,粉碎箱1的一侧设置有电机4,粉碎箱1内设置有振筛机构,振筛机构包括转杆5,转杆5与电机4的输出轴固定连接,转杆5上固定安装有两个凸轮6,粉碎箱1内固定安装有两个斜槽7,两个斜槽7上均固定安装有多个复位弹簧8,粉碎箱1内滑动安装有过滤板9,两个凸轮6与过滤板9相互配合,过滤板9上固定安装有两个槽盒10,两个槽盒10与两个斜槽7滑动连接,粉碎箱1内设置有粉碎机构。Referring to Figures 1 to 3, a crushing device for concrete production includes a crushing box 1, two cylinders 2 are arranged on both sides of the crushing box 1, and extrusion needle plates 3 are fixedly installed on the telescopic rods of the two cylinders 2, and the two extrusion needle plates 3 cooperate with each other. A motor 4 is arranged on one side of the crushing box 1, and a vibrating screen mechanism is arranged in the crushing box 1. The vibrating screen mechanism includes a rotating rod 5, which is fixedly connected to the output shaft of the motor 4, and two cams 6 are fixedly installed on the rotating rod 5. Two inclined slots 7 are fixedly installed in the crushing box 1, and a plurality of return springs 8 are fixedly installed on the two inclined slots 7. A filter plate 9 is slidably installed in the crushing box 1, and the two cams 6 cooperate with the filter plate 9. Two slot boxes 10 are fixedly installed on the filter plate 9, and the two slot boxes 10 are slidably connected to the two inclined slots 7. A crushing mechanism is arranged in the crushing box 1.

参照图2-图4,粉碎机构包括第一带轮11,第一带轮11与转杆5固定连接,粉碎箱1上转动安装有第一齿轮14和第二齿轮15,第一齿轮14和第二齿轮15相啮合,第一齿轮14上固定安装有第二带轮12,第一带轮11和第二带轮12上传动安装有同一个皮带13,第一齿轮14和第二齿轮15上均固定安装有粉碎辊16。2-4, the crushing mechanism includes a first pulley 11, which is fixedly connected to the rotating rod 5, a first gear 14 and a second gear 15 are rotatably mounted on the crushing box 1, the first gear 14 and the second gear 15 are meshed with each other, a second pulley 12 is fixedly mounted on the first gear 14, the first pulley 11 and the second pulley 12 are driven by the same belt 13, and crushing rollers 16 are fixedly mounted on the first gear 14 and the second gear 15.

参照图2-图5,粉碎箱1内设置有收拢槽17,收拢槽17设置在两个粉碎辊16的上方,收拢槽17的设置能够收拢混凝土原料,方便再次粉碎混凝土原料。2 to 5 , a gathering groove 17 is provided in the crushing box 1 , and the gathering groove 17 is provided above the two crushing rollers 16 . The setting of the gathering groove 17 can gather the concrete raw materials, so as to facilitate the crushing of the concrete raw materials again.

参照图2,粉碎箱1内设置有两个槽轨,两个槽轨均与过滤板9滑动连接,槽轨的设置能够使得过滤板9在固定位置稳定滑动。2 , two groove rails are provided in the crushing box 1 , and both groove rails are slidably connected to the filter plate 9 . The provision of the groove rails enables the filter plate 9 to slide stably at a fixed position.

参照图2,粉碎箱1内设置有两个轴承,两个轴承的内圈均与转杆5固定连接,轴承的设置能够使得转杆5在固定位置稳定转动。2 , two bearings are arranged in the crushing box 1 , and the inner rings of the two bearings are fixedly connected to the rotating rod 5 . The arrangement of the bearings enables the rotating rod 5 to rotate stably at a fixed position.

参照图4,粉碎箱1内转动安装有两个转轴,两个转轴分别与第一齿轮14和第二齿轮15固定连接,转轴的设置能够使得第一齿轮14和第二齿轮15在固定位置稳定转动。4 , two rotating shafts are rotatably installed in the crushing box 1 , and the two rotating shafts are fixedly connected to the first gear 14 and the second gear 15 respectively. The arrangement of the rotating shafts enables the first gear 14 and the second gear 15 to stably rotate at a fixed position.

参照图1-图2,粉碎箱1的顶部设置有进料口,粉碎箱1的一侧设置有出料口。1-2 , a feed port is disposed on the top of the crushing box 1 , and a discharge port is disposed on one side of the crushing box 1 .

本实施例中,在需要粉碎混凝土原料时,将原料加入到粉碎箱1内,启动两个气缸2,带动两个挤压针板3来回移动,挤压粉碎大块的混凝土原料,启动电机4,进而带动转杆5转动,进而带动两个凸轮6转动,挤压过滤板9,在多个复位弹簧8的弹力作用下,使得过滤板9不断震动,筛选小块的原料,转杆5转动,进而带动第一带轮11转动,在皮带13的配合下,第一带轮11带动第二带轮12转动,进而带动第一齿轮14转动,进而带动第二齿轮15反向转动,使得两个粉碎辊16相向转动,能够再次粉碎混凝土原料,粉碎效果好。In this embodiment, when it is necessary to crush the concrete raw materials, the raw materials are added into the crushing box 1, and the two cylinders 2 are started to drive the two extrusion needle plates 3 to move back and forth to squeeze and crush the large pieces of concrete raw materials. The motor 4 is started to drive the rotating rod 5 to rotate, and then drive the two cams 6 to rotate to squeeze the filter plate 9. Under the elastic force of multiple reset springs 8, the filter plate 9 is continuously vibrated to screen small pieces of raw materials. The rotating rod 5 rotates, and then drives the first pulley 11 to rotate. With the cooperation of the belt 13, the first pulley 11 drives the second pulley 12 to rotate, and then drives the first gear 14 to rotate, and then drives the second gear 15 to rotate in the opposite direction, so that the two crushing rollers 16 rotate in the opposite direction, which can crush the concrete raw materials again and have a good crushing effect.

实施例二Embodiment 2

参照图6,本实施例与实施例一的区别在于:粉碎箱1上设置有两个吸尘口18,两个吸尘口18上连接有同一个吸风管,吸风管上连接有风机,风机的一侧连接有水箱,在粉碎混凝土原料时,启动风机,通过吸风管和两个吸尘口18将粉碎后的碎屑抽出,并排出到水箱内,能够避免灰尘飘到外界污染工作环境。6 , the difference between this embodiment and the first embodiment is that two dust suction ports 18 are provided on the crushing box 1, the two dust suction ports 18 are connected to the same air suction pipe, the air suction pipe is connected to a fan, one side of the fan is connected to a water tank, when the concrete raw materials are crushed, the fan is started, the crushed debris is extracted through the air suction pipe and the two dust suction ports 18, and discharged into the water tank, which can prevent dust from floating to the outside and polluting the working environment.
